English
Proper noun
ATEAC
- (historical) Initialism of Advanced Technology External Advisory Council, a short-lived AI ethics council set up by Google.
2019 April 5, Sam Levin, “Google scraps AI ethics council after backlash: ‘Back to the drawing board’”, in The Guardian:“It’s become clear that in the current environment, ATEAC can’t function as we wanted. So we’re ending the council and going back to the drawing board,” a Google spokesperson told the Guardian in a statement on Thursday.
